So two siblings with the same mom have different halves from their dads and two siblings with the same dad have different halves from … WebMar 6, 2015 · Different races have different likelihoods of having fraternal twins, too. Amongst Caucasians, about eight in 1000 births are un-identical twins, but that rises to 16 per 1000 amongst those of African descent, and drops to four per 1000 amongst Asians. In another interesting twin fact, fraternal twins can have different fathers. Non-identical twins. Non-identical (dizygotic) twins happen when 2 separate eggs are fertilised and then implant into the womb (uterus). These non-identical twins are no more alike than any other 2 siblings. Non-identical twins are more common.
